Who is t ray from The Secret Life of Bees?

T. Ray is a character in the novel "The Secret Life of Bees" by Sue Monk Kidd. He is Lily Owens' abusive and distant father who struggles with his own inner demons and treats Lily poorly throughout the story.

What is the allusion in chapter 1 in dies drear?

The allusion in Chapter 1 of "The House of Dies Drear" is to the Underground Railroad, a network of secret routes and safe houses used by 19th-century enslaved African Americans to escape to free states and Canada. The reference sets the tone for the theme of hidden histories and connections throughout the novel.


What does allusion make the audience think about?

Allusion reminds the reader of a previous occurrence or event and thus evokes a certain mood or feeling as the reader associates the current work to a previous work. It also add layers of meaning to the particular text.


What is the rising action in inventing Elliot by graham gardner?

The rising action in "Inventing Elliot" by Graham Gardner involves the protagonist, Elliot, transforming himself from a bullied and insecure teenager to a confident and powerful figure after joining a secret society at his new school. As Elliot navigates his newfound identity and relationships within the group, tensions start to rise, leading to a climax that challenges his moral compass.
